Add fast paths for Math.pow and Math.sqrt
https://bugs.webkit.org/show_bug.cgi?id=38294

Add specialized thunks for Math.pow and Math.sqrt.
This requires adding a sqrtDouble function to the MacroAssembler
and sqrtsd to the x86 assembler.

Math.pow is slightly more complicated, in that we have
to implement exponentiation ourselves rather than relying
on hardware support. The inline exponentiation is restricted
to positive integer exponents on a numeric base. Exponentiation
is finally performed through the "Exponentiation by Squaring"
algorithm.
